About Columbus Metro

The Columbus-Marion-Zanesville Region offers a dynamic mix of urban sophistication, small-town charm, and scenic Midwest landscapes. Anchored by Columbus, the state capital and one of the fastest-growing cities in the Midwest, this region seamlessly connects vibrant city life with the historic appeal of communities like Marion and Zanesville.

Whether you’re bustling downtown Columbus, strolling through Marion’s historic district, or exploring Zanesville’s art-filled streets and famous Y-Bridge, this region delivers a diverse and connected living experience. Residents enjoy easy access to major highways, thriving local businesses, and cultural destinations that span across central and southeastern Ohio.

    What to Love

    There’s something for everyone in the Columbus-Marion-Zanesville Region. Columbus is home to top-tier attractions like the Short North Arts District, the Scioto Mile, and the Columbus Museum of Art, while Marion offers a deep sense of heritage with landmarks like the Harding Home and lively community events.

    Columbus Metro Area
    Downtown Columbus, Short North, Dublin, and Westerville are popular for their dining, entertainment, and proximity to major employers and universities.

    Marion, Ohio
    Marion offers a quieter atmosphere with convenient access to parks, shopping centers, and regional employers, ideal for those seeking a balanced lifestyle.

    Zanesville, Ohio
    Known for its historic charm and scenic setting along the Muskingum River, Zanesville appeals to residents who value character, outdoor access, and a close-knit community.

    Arts, Culture & Entertainment
    Columbus features a vibrant arts scene, professional sports, concerts, and festivals throughout the year.

    Outdoor Recreation
    The region is home to scenic parks, nature preserves, bike trails, and waterways, including Hocking Hills nearby and rivers running through Marion and Zanesville.

    Shopping & Dining
    From Short North boutiques and Easton Town Center to local restaurants and shops in Marion and Zanesville, the area offers a wide variety of dining and retail experiences.
     

    Columbus Employment Hub
    Columbus is home to major employers in education, healthcare, technology, finance, and government, including The Ohio State University and several Fortune 500 companies.

    Marion Area Employers
    Manufacturing, healthcare, and logistics play a strong role in Marion’s economy, offering diverse career opportunities.

    Zanesville Workforce Opportunities
    Zanesville supports employment in healthcare, manufacturing, education, and public services, contributing to a stable regional job market.
